Как создать резервную копию базы данных с помощью MySQL Workbench


Создание регулярных резервных копий вашей базы данных MySQL является основой для обеспечения безопасности ваших данных. Бэкапы помогают предотвратить потерю данных в случае непредвиденных сбоев в системе, ошибок пользователя или злонамеренных атак.

Одним из наиболее популярных инструментов для управления базами данных MySQL является MySQL Workbench. С его помощью вы можете выполнять различные задачи, включая создание резервной копии базы данных.

Чтобы создать бэкап базы данных MySQL Workbench, вам потребуется открыть программу и подключиться к вашему серверу баз данных. Затем выберите соответствующую базу данных, которую вы хотите сохранить, и перейдите в раздел «Server» в главном меню. В этом разделе вы найдете различные опции, включая «Data Export».

При выборе опции «Data Export» вы увидите различные настройки и параметры экспорта данных, а также возможность выбрать формат файла для сохранения вашей резервной копии. Не забудьте указать путь сохранения файла и выбрать соответствующие таблицы и данные, которые вы хотите включить в бэкап.

Подготовка к созданию бэкапа

Перед тем как приступить к созданию бэкапа базы данных в MySQL Workbench, необходимо выполнить ряд подготовительных шагов:

  1. Убедитесь, что вы подключены к серверу базы данных MySQL Workbench и имеете необходимые права доступа для создания бэкапа.
  2. Определите, какие базы данных вы хотите сохранить в бэкапе. Вам может понадобиться создать отдельный бэкап для каждой базы данных.
  3. Определите место, где вы хотите сохранить бэкап. Можно выбрать локальный или удаленный диск, а также сетевое хранилище.
  4. Решите, какой формат бэкапа вам нужен. MySQL Workbench предлагает несколько форматов, включая SQL-файлы и ZIP-архивы.
  5. Выполните необходимые настройки, если требуется. Например, вы можете указать дополнительные опции, такие как кодировка или форматирование SQL-кода.

После выполнения всех подготовительных шагов вы будете готовы приступить к созданию бэкапа базы данных в MySQL Workbench.

Выбор базы данных для создания бэкапа

MySQL является одной из самых популярных реляционных баз данных и широко используется в веб-разработке. Однако, на рынке также есть и другие распространенные базы данных, такие как PostgreSQL, Oracle, Microsoft SQL Server и другие. При выборе базы данных для создания бэкапа, вам необходимо убедиться, что MySQL Workbench поддерживает выбранную вами базу данных.

Один из способов узнать поддерживает ли MySQL Workbench вашу базу данных, — это официальная документация MySQL Workbench. В документации вы найдете список поддерживаемых баз данных, а также инструкции по созданию резервной копии для каждой из поддерживаемых баз данных.

Кроме того, следует учитывать версию базы данных при выборе базы данных для создания бэкапа. Некоторые функции и возможности создания резервных копий могут быть доступны только для определенных версий базы данных.

В итоге, выбор базы данных для создания бэкапа зависит от ваших конкретных потребностей и требований проекта. Тщательно изучите документацию MySQL Workbench и убедитесь, что ваша база данных поддерживается и вам доступны все необходимые функции для создания успешного бэкапа.

Установка MySQL Workbench

Чтобы начать работать с MySQL Workbench и создавать резервные копии базы данных, вам сначала необходимо установить эту программу. Для этого следуйте инструкциям:

  1. Откройте официальный сайт MySQL и перейдите на страницу загрузок.
  2. Выберите версию MySQL Workbench, соответствующую операционной системе вашего компьютера, и нажмите ссылку для загрузки.
  3. Сохраните загруженный файл на вашем компьютере.
  4. После завершения загрузки откройте файл-установщик и следуйте инструкциям мастера установки.
  5. Выберите путь для установки MySQL Workbench и выполните все необходимые настройки (если требуется).
  6. Дождитесь окончания установки программы.

Теперь вы готовы начать работу с MySQL Workbench и создавать резервные копии базы данных для последующего использования.

Введите ваш текст здесь…

Создание нового подключения к базе данных

Для создания нового подключения к базе данных в MySQL Workbench следуйте следующим шагам:

  1. Откройте MySQL Workbench и выберите раздел «Создать новое подключение к базе данных», который находится на главной странице приложения.
  2. Введите название подключения в поле «Имя подключения». Например, «Моя база данных».
  3. Выберите тип подключения. В данном случае выберите «Соединение TCP/IP».
  4. Укажите информацию для подключения к базе данных: имя хоста, номер порта, имя пользователя, пароль и остальные необходимые данные. Если вы не уверены в некоторых параметрах, обратитесь к администратору базы данных.
  5. Проверьте, что все данные введены корректно, и нажмите кнопку «Тест подключения», чтобы убедиться, что подключение работает правильно.
  6. Если тест прошел успешно, нажмите кнопку «Применить» для сохранения настроек подключения.
  7. Теперь вы можете использовать новое подключение для работы с базой данных в MySQL Workbench.

Создание нового подключения к базе данных в MySQL Workbench довольно просто и позволяет легко управлять базами данных. Запомните, что для каждой базы данных необходимо создавать отдельное подключение.

Выбор метода создания бэкапа

  • Ручное резервное копирование: данная опция позволяет вручную создать резервную копию базы данных. Для этого необходимо выбрать базу данных, затем в контекстном меню выбрать опцию «Резервное копирование». Этот метод обладает гибкостью, так как позволяет выбрать только нужные таблицы или данные для резервного копирования.
  • Автоматическое резервное копирование: данный метод позволяет настроить автоматическое создание резервной копии базы данных в определенное время или с определенной периодичностью. Для этого необходимо воспользоваться опцией «Планировщик резервного копирования» в меню инструментов MySQL Workbench. Этот метод удобен, так как позволяет автоматизировать процесс создания резервной копии.
  • Использование командной строки: для создания резервной копии базы данных можно использовать командную строку. Для этого необходимо выполнить соответствующую команду: mysqldump -u [пользователь] -p [пароль] [имя_базы_данных] > [путь_к_файлу]. Этот метод подходит для опытных пользователей и разработчиков, так как требует некоторых знаний командной строки.

Выбор метода создания бэкапа зависит от требуемого уровня гибкости и автоматизации, а также от знаний и опыта пользователя. В любом случае, создание регулярных резервных копий базы данных является хорошей практикой для обеспечения безопасности ваших данных.

Установка расписания создания регулярных бэкапов

После того, как вы научились создавать бэкап базы данных в MySQL Workbench, вы можете установить расписание для регулярного создания бэкапов. Это позволит вам автоматически создавать копии базы данных в заданные интервалы времени без необходимости вмешательства пользователя.

Для установки расписания создания регулярных бэкапов в MySQL Workbench вам понадобится использовать функциональность событий («Events»). Создание событий позволит вам автоматически запускать процедуру создания бэкапа базы данных в заданные дни и временные интервалы. Ниже приведены шаги, которые вы можете выполнить для установки расписания создания регулярных бэкапов в MySQL Workbench:

  1. Откройте MySQL Workbench и подключитесь к вашему серверу баз данных.
  2. Выберите вашу базу данных в окне «Schemas» слева.
  3. В верхнем меню выберите «Server» и затем «Data Import».
  4. В появившемся окне выберите вкладку «Scheduled Tasks».
  5. Нажмите кнопку «New Task» для создания нового события.
  6. Установите желаемые параметры для вашего события, такие как имя события, частоту повторения и время выполнения.
  7. В разделе «Action» выберите пункт «Export to Disk», чтобы создать бэкап базы данных.
  8. Укажите путь к папке, в которой вы хотите сохранить бэкап базы данных.
  9. Нажмите кнопку «Apply» для сохранения настроек события.

Теперь у вас установлено расписание создания регулярных бэкапов базы данных. MySQL Workbench будет автоматически создавать бэкапы в заданные дни и временные интервалы, сохраняя их в указанную папку. Это обеспечит вам постоянную защиту данных и уверенность в их безопасности.

Будьте внимательны при установке расписания, чтобы не нагружать сервер лишними операциями создания бэкапов. Корректная настройка интервалов и частоты повторения очень важна для предотвращения возможных проблем с производительностью сервера и доступностью базы данных.

Запуск процесса создания бэкапа

Создание резервной копии базы данных MySQL Workbench может быть выполнено с помощью следующих шагов:

  1. Откройте MySQL Workbench.
  2. Выберите соединение с базой данных, для которой вы хотите создать бэкап.
  3. В главном меню выберите пункт «Server» и затем «Data Export».
  4. В появившемся окне «Data Export» выберите схему базы данных, которую хотите сохранить в бэкапе.
  5. Выберите место, где вы хотите сохранить резервную копию базы данных.
  6. Выберите формат файла для резервной копии (например, .sql или .csv).
  7. Нажмите кнопку «Start Export» для начала процесса создания бэкапа.
  8. Подождите, пока процесс создания бэкапа завершится.
  9. После завершения процесса создания бэкапа вы можете проверить файл резервной копии в выбранном вами месте.

Теперь вы знаете, как запустить процесс создания бэкапа базы данных с помощью MySQL Workbench. Это очень важно для обеспечения безопасности и сохранности ваших данных.

Важно:Периодически выполняйте резервное копирование базы данных, чтобы избежать потери данных.

Проверка и восстановление бэкапа базы данных

После создания бэкапа базы данных в MySQL Workbench рекомендуется проверить его целостность перед тем, как использовать его для восстановления данных. Это позволит убедиться, что бэкап был создан успешно и не содержит ошибок.

Для проверки бэкапа базы данных можно воспользоваться командой mysqlcheck в командной строке. Синтаксис команды выглядит следующим образом:

КомандаОписание
mysqlcheck -u [пользователь] -p [пароль] —check [имя_базы_данных]Проверяет целостность всех таблиц в указанной базе данных
mysqlcheck -u [пользователь] -p [пароль] —check [имя_базы_данных] [имя_таблицы]Проверяет целостность указанной таблицы в указанной базе данных

Замените [пользователь], [пароль], [имя_базы_данных] и [имя_таблицы] соответствующими значениями. При выполнении команды вам может потребоваться ввести пароль пользователя базы данных.

Если команда mysqlcheck не выдает ошибок, то бэкап базы данных можно считать целостным и готовым к восстановлению.

Для восстановления данных из бэкапа базы данных в MySQL Workbench можно воспользоваться функцией Data Import в меню Server. Следуйте указанным ниже шагам для восстановления бэкапа:

  1. Откройте MySQL Workbench и подключитесь к серверу базы данных.
  2. В меню Server выберите пункт Data Import.
  3. В появившемся окне выберите опцию Import from Self-Contained File и укажите путь к файлу бэкапа базы данных.
  4. Выберите целевую базу данных для восстановления данных.
  5. Нажмите кнопку Start Import для начала процесса восстановления.
  6. После успешного восстановления вы увидите сообщение об успешном выполнении операции.

Обратите внимание, что восстановление данных из бэкапа базы данных может занять некоторое время и может повлиять на работу сервера базы данных. Убедитесь, что у вас есть достаточно ресурсов и позволено подключение для выполнения этой операции.

Добавить комментарий

Вам также может понравиться